What are the trends and disparities in the use of implantable cardioverter-defibrillator therapy among patients hospitalized for heart failure?
While racial disparities in ICD utilization for heart failure patients have resolved over time, significant sex-based disparities in therapy use persist.
In the GWTG-HF quality improvement program, a significant increase in ICD therapy use was observed over time in all sex and race groups. The previously described racial disparities in ICD use were no longer present by the end of the study period; however, sex differences persisted.
